The Royal Commission for AlUla (RCU) and General Hotel Management Ltd (GHM) have launched The Chedi Hegra. This groundbreaking project redefines luxury tourism in AlUla, Saudi Arabia’s first UNESCO World Heritage Site. Located within the ancient Nabataean site of Hegra, the hotel combines rich history, modern comfort, and cultural immersion.
The property is Saudi Arabia’s first seven-star hotel, offering a unique experience of history and luxury. Guests can enjoy 35 bespoke guest rooms that seamlessly integrate with the surrounding natural landscape. The rooms incorporate historical structures, such as the Hegra railway station, blending cultural heritage with contemporary design.

Commitment to Sustainability and Job Creation
The Chedi Hegra prioritizes sustainability, aligning with RCU’s Sustainability Charter for AlUla. The project ensures minimal environmental impact by using local materials and sustainable practices. The hotel’s development also aims to boost the local economy by creating at least 120 jobs in the region.
Gaps in the historic masonry were restored using lime-based materials to preserve the site’s integrity. Modern plumbing and electrical systems were added within the original stone walls. Earthen buildings on-site were transformed into luxurious spa and gym facilities.
Culinary Experiences and Exclusive Amenities
Guests can indulge in three distinct dining experiences, each offering a unique blend of history and cuisine. Prima Classe, housed in the former Hegra railway station, features a fine dining experience alongside a heritage exhibition. The Fort Restaurant is within Hegra Fort’s historic walls, while The Water Basin Restaurant offers breathtaking views of Hegra’s landscape.
The Chedi Spa provides six treatment rooms, two hydrothermal rooms, and two post-treatment areas. Additional amenities include a fitness center and a pool, housed in transformed mudbrick villas.
Immersive Experiences, Cultural Enrichment
From the moment guests arrive, The Chedi Hegra offers an immersive experience showcasing AlUla’s unique character. Welcome drinks reflect local traditions, and bespoke in-room amenities include local dates and nuts. The hotel also features a Saudi Coffee House, where guests can learn about this cultural staple.
Outside the hotel, curated experiences allow visitors to explore wildlife reserves, enjoy traditional falcon shows, or join Bedouin expeditions. These activities foster a deeper connection to AlUla’s cultural and natural heritage.
